The Dig Dug Pocket Player is one of many collectible handheld game consoles by My Arcade. Fygars, Pookas, and falling rocks. Join Dig Dug on the ultimate adventure to vanquish underground monsters. Making his first appearance in Japan in 1982, the airpump wielding hero has since become an arcade legend. My Arcade Pocket Players are portable handheld gaming systems for kids and adults alike. They feature high quality artwork inspired by original arcade machines and are boxed in collectible packaging that can be displayed in homes and offices. Fully playable and perfect for fans of retro gaming, Pocket Players feature 2.75 inch full color displays, front facing speakers with volume controls, and headphone jacks. They are powered via micro USB or 4 AAA batteries, which are not included. These handhelds are compact and easy to take along for offline gaming sessions in long car rides, road trips, airplane flights, train rides, and more.

AirXonix is a modern 3-dimensional remake of the famous Xonix game. In the older Xonix you controlled a device, which moved over a field with several monster-balls wandering inside. The objective was to cut the balls away from as much spare field as possible. The rules of AirXonix are almost the same, except the device you control is flying in the air and everything is in full 3D! The stunning special effects are strengthened by 3D sound! New types of monsters and a slew of different bonuses all displayed in full 3D bring the old game to an entirely new level. The complete AirXonix distribution includes 5 types of games with more then 80 levels. The rules are simple and the game will give unforgettable pleasure to people of any age!

Angry Birds Hatchery Island is a cancelled game based on the Angry Birds series. The game featured a new mode called Hatchery, alongside the ability to make custom birds. An early prototype build of the game was leaked on December 17th, 2023 during the TestFlight teraleaks.

Xonix is a classic arcade-style DOS game which was probably inspired by Qix. In the game, the player controls a small marker that moves on a rectangular playfield. The goal is to claim a certain percentage of the playfield by drawing lines with the marker around areas that have not been claimed yet. The player must avoid collisions with balls bouncing around the playfield to avoid losing a life.
